| 1296308 | 2012-08-23 03:32:00 | I've just connected to broadband with a wireless router/modem and now want to connect another desktop pc using wireless. The modem is a NetComm N300. Should I use a pci wireless card or a usb plugin in the second pc? The distance apart of the two pc's is approx 20 metres. Thanks |

| 1296310 | 2012-08-23 03:41:00 | Use a USB stick. PCI cards are usually more expensive, you have to open the case to install it and the signal may not be that great. With a uSB stick you can use a USB extension lead and move it around a bit to find the best signal and they are easier to install. |

| 1296312 | 2012-08-25 22:57:00 | www.alfanetwork.co.nz 20m should not be an issue for wireless, if you are connecting through walls, floors etc, signal strength can be unpredictable. Can you try the computer that currently has wireless in the location for the second computer you want to connect? If you get excellent signal strength, then a simple USB Wifi device should be fine. If the strength is low, you may want to consider a device that has a better antenna / power such as this: Alfa high power USB (www.alfanetwork.co.nz) | wuppo (41) | ||
